The 24609 Orion 1.25" Extra-Narrowband Tri-Color CCD Filter Set is an exceptional tool for astrophotographers looking to capture the subtleties of deep-sky objects in vibrant detail. This set consists of three filters: H-alpha, OIII, and SII, each designed to specifically isolate and enhance the emission of hydrogen, oxygen, and sulfur, respectively.
The H-alpha filter allows you to capture the red glow of nebulae, such as the Orion Nebula, with exceptional clarity and contrast. The OIII filter, on the other hand, is perfect for bringing out the blue-green hues of emission nebulae, like the Horsehead Nebula. Finally, the SII filter helps to reveal the subtler green tones found in nebulae, like the Eagle Nebula.
Each filter in this set is made with high-quality optical glasses and multi-coated to minimize reflection and increase light transmission. They are also extra-narrowband, which means they have a very narrow transmission bandpass, allowing for the maximum isolation of the specific wavelengths of light they are designed to capture.

All three Orion filters are par focal with each other, so refocusing is not needed when switching between in the set.
